Bug Description

1. Originally I could choose the different input method (latin-letter or EN) by right clicking the icon on the sidebar, now the effect of right click and left click are the same (it will show the setting of gcin instead of the list of input method).

2. If you click the icon and choose "choose input method", you can still choose the input method, but notice the first icon "EN ctrl-alt-e" is missing.
